A: Yes, the AOC 2590FX is a 144Hz capable monitor. To make sure it runs at max refresh rate, you will need a DisplayPort/DP cable. People report that they are able to set it to 144Hz with the included HDMI cable as well. HDMI will surely get you to 120Hz, as to 144Hz, see other Q&A. Then you will need to set the display adapter to the 144Hz manually. It is normally set to run at 60Hz, so you'll have to change it to 144Hz yourself. It's not complicated, perhaps you do know. Anyway, for anyone else, to do that, yone needs to enter Display Settings (right click on your empty desktop & you'll see that option), then go to Advanced Display Settings, then click on Display adapter properties under all the info, then on the newly opened window click on List All Modes, scroll and click on 144Hz, then Ok, then Apply (the screen will go black and then return), then confirm Keep Changes.
